    Tamina Bridge
    The largest arch bridge in Switzerland
    The Tamina Bridge connects the two villages of Pfäfers and Valens at the entrance to the Tamina Valley. The bridge arches impressively over the deep Tamina Gorge, where the famous 36.5° thermal water arises. With a span of 260 meters and a length of 475 meters, the Tamina Bridge is the largest arch bridge in Switzerland and one of the largest of its kind in Europe.
    Find out more on a 1-hour tour (CHF 150.00) including a short presentation with lots of pictures from the construction period.

      Tamina Bridge Valens - Pfäfers (Tamina Arch)
      Construction of the largest arch bridge in Switzerland and one of the largest in Europe. The bridge crosses the Tamina Gorge at a height of 200 meters and has an arch span of over 260 meters.
      2018 winner at the Structural Awards in London
      The Tamina Gorge has its own arch, the Taminabogen.
      The bridge from Pfäfers to Valens was built to replace the steep and expensive mountain road from Bad Ragaz to Valens. This means that the dangerous section of Valenserstrasse is bypassed. In addition, the new connecting road will relieve pressure on the village center of Bad Ragaz. The entire Tamina Valley is only accessible via Pfäferserstrasse.
      The Tamina Arch crosses the Tamina Gorge at a height of 200 meters and has a span of over 400 meters.
      Facts Tamina Bridge - total length 475 m - bridge superstructure 417 m - arch span 260 m - height above valley floor 200 m - bridge width 9.5 m
